April 5, 2004
Torque Launches Technology Services Firm IT Lighthouse

Torque Ltd., a brand-launch and integrated marketing communications firm, announced the launch of the marketing campaign for technology services firm IT Lighthouse. IT Lighthouse specializes in providing technology services to small- to medium-sized companies, and seeks to build its business as a highly economical franchise-style service offering. The company will reach its under-served target markets through a unique blend of CRM, nurture marketing and affiliate programs.

IT Lighthouse responded dramatic market changes and increased pressure by creating a streamlined, franchise-based approach to delivering IT management services, in the form of several fixed-fee packages. The service is designed for businesses with 10 to 100 computer users, and offers optional hardware sales, financing, and remote systems monitoring and management. The Chicago area market consists of tens of thousands of underserved potential customers, making it ripe for IT Lighthouse’s offering. With its ‘franchise-like’ operating and marketing model, IT Lighthouse intends to take the concept into other markets.

IT Lighthouse engaged Torque to name and brand the company’s offerings, and launch the business concept with a program designed to create visibility and generate leads through ongoing nurturing communications, an incentivised affiliate program, and online marketing.
